Frequently Asked Questions about Core Web Vitals

What are Core Web Vitals and why are they important for my website?

Core Web Vitals are a set of specific factors that Google considers important in a webpage’s overall user experience. They measure your site’s loading performance, interactivity, and visual stability. These metrics are crucial because they directly impact your website’s search engine rankings and user satisfaction.

Key Stat: Websites that meet Core Web Vitals thresholds are 24% less likely to have visitors abandon their pages.

Example: An e-commerce client improved their Core Web Vitals scores and saw a 15% increase in organic traffic and a 7% boost in conversions within three months.

How can I improve my website’s Largest Contentful Paint (LCP) score?

To improve your LCP score, focus on optimizing your site’s loading performance. Key strategies include minimizing server response times, optimizing and compressing images, implementing efficient caching policies, and prioritizing critical rendering paths.

How can we ensure our Core Web Vitals scores remain optimized over time as we update our website?

Maintaining optimized Core Web Vitals requires ongoing monitoring and proactive management. Implement a continuous performance monitoring system, establish performance budgets for new features, and conduct regular audits. Additionally, train your development team on performance best practices to maintain optimization as your site evolves.
